WebAn arc flash study is an engineered incident energy analysis defined to establish safety protocol for qualified electrical personnel required to work on electrical equipment and circuit parts that cannot be placed in an … WebFeb 16, 2024 · Arc flash training is specialized training to help professionals understand the dangers and precautions regarding the arc flash event. The training typically lasts around a day; at the end, the professional should be competent in determining arc flash risk potential and complete an arc flash risk assessment.
